Peaches poached with bourbon

Yield: 5 12oz jars

Total time: 2h 30m

Active time 30 mins
    4lbs  peaches, (about 12)
    2.5 c  sugar
    2  vanilla beans, split and scraped, pods preserved
    1 c  bourbon

1) bring large pot water to boil, and prepare ice water bath. Cut a small X in bottom of each peach. Boil peaches 1 min.

2) transfer to ice bath. Let cool slightly. Peel & pit peaches, cut into 3/4" wedges.

3) bring 4c water to boil, along with sugar, vanilla seeds and pods in large saucepan, stirring until sugar dissolves. Add peaches & bourbon. Simmer until peaches are tender but still hold their shape, 5-7 mins.

4) transfer peaches to large bowl using slotted spoon. Cook syrup over medium heat until reduced by half, 15 mins. Pour over peaches. Let cool completely.

5) divide peaches among five 12oz jars using slotted spoon. Pour syrup over top. Seal jars and refrigerate until ready to use. Can be stored for up to 1 month in refrigerator.
